Union took a pair of wins over Sebastopol to take the drivers seat in division play.
The Lady Yellowjackets finished a previously started game and beat Sebastopol 9-5 and then followed that up with an 8-7 win over the Lady Bobcats. In their other game last week, the Lady Yellowjackets lost a 13-3 decision to Newton County.
“We were 2-7 at one time and are now 8-8,” Union coach Jacob Casey said. “I think if we can be more consistent on offense, we’ve got a chance to be pretty good. Right now, we are 4-0 in the district and in good shape there.”
Union 9, Sebastopol 5
The Lady Jackets took their first win of the week against the Lady Bobcats, finishing off a game that was postponed because of rain.
Union led 3-0 when the game was restarted in the fourth inning.
Macy Lott and Lilly Burton each had a double and a single while Kayleigh Vance had two singles. Parker Breland and Ansley Rigby each had doubles in the contest as Union banged out 12 hits.
Newton County 13, Union 3
The Lady Yellowjackets came out of the gate fast with three runs in the first inning. But County used a 10-run third inning to take control of the contest. Union managed six hits, as Mackenzie Dolan had two singles.
Union 8, Sebastopol 7
The Lady Yellowjackets had a pair of big innings as they held on to take a one-run win over the Lady Bobcats and sweep the season series.
The Lady Jackets had 10 hits in the contest as Ashlynn Jenkins led the way with three singles. Lilly Burton had a double and a single while Parker Breland had a pair of singles.
